Lose yourselves in the labyrinthine streets of Old Cairo, a ancient haven where history whispers on every corner. Discover hidden gems, from centuries-old mosques and churches to bustling souks. Every stroll you take reveals a new story, etched in the very fabric of this vibrant city. Discover the charming alleyways, overflowing with the scents of